Label LIVE features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Label LIVE offers an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face that reduces the learning curve for new users and allows for quick design and printing of labels.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    The software is compatible with both macOS and Windows, making it a versatile choice for users across different operating systems.
  • Wide Range of Features
    It provides a robust set of features including barcode generation, custom label templates, and integration with popular data sources.
  • Time-Saving Automation
    Automation features like batch printing and data integration can significantly reduce the time and effort required for repetitive labeling tasks.

Possible disadvantages of Label LIVE

  • Limited Advanced Design Tools
    While the software is sufficient for basic label design, it may lack some advanced design tools needed for more complex or custom designs.
  • Cost
    Label LIVE might be relatively expensive for small businesses or individuals with limited label printing needs compared to other simpler solutions.
  • Dependence on Internet Connectivity
    Some features may require internet connectivity, which can be a limitation for users needing offline access or in areas with poor internet service.
  • Learning Curve for Complex Features
    While the basic features are intuitive, mastering the more complex capabilities of the software might require additional training or support.

WordPress features and specs

  • User-Friendly
    WordPress is very intuitive and easy to use, which makes it accessible to users with minimal technical expertise.
  • Customization
    It offers a vast array of themes and plugins, allowing users to customize their websites extensively without any coding knowledge.
  • SEO-Friendly
    WordPress has numerous SEO features and plugins that can help websites rank higher in search engine results pages.
  • Community Support
    There is a large and active WordPress community that provides extensive documentation, forums, and third-party resources.
  • Scalability
    WordPress can grow with your business, as it supports both small blogs and large corporate websites.
  • Open Source
    Being an open-source platform, WordPress is free to use, and users can modify the source code to suit their needs.
  • Large Ecosystem
    WordPress offers one of the largest ecosystems of developers, themes, and plugins, providing a lot of options for site building.

Possible disadvantages of WordPress

  • Security Vulnerabilities
    WordPress is a popular target for hackers, which makes it susceptible to security issues if not properly maintained.
  • Maintenance
    Regular updates to the core software, themes, and plugins are necessary to keep the site secure and functioning correctly.
  • Performance
    Websites with many plugins or poorly optimized themes can suffer from slow loading times, impacting user experience.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While basic use is straightforward, leveraging WordPress's full capabilities can require more advanced knowledge and learning.
  • Potential for Plugin Conflicts
    Installing multiple plugins from different developers can sometimes cause conflicts, leading to site instability or performance problems.
  • Customization Complexity
    Extensive customization may require coding knowledge in languages like PHP, HTML, and CSS, which can be a barrier for beginners.
  • Hosting Dependency
    Users need to purchase their own hosting services and manage that aspect, which may be complicated for non-technical users.

WordPress vs. Proprietary Site Builders: What to Know Before Starting a Website Development Project
WordPress: WordPress.org (not to be confused with WordPress.com) is an open-source content management system (CMS). When you build a website on WordPress, you own the code, the design, and the data. This means you can fully customize your site, transfer it to any hosting provider, and have complete control over all aspects of the website. The site can be hosted on any...

  • Ask HN: Anyone tired of everything being a subscription now?
    I deeply want to understand and solve this problem. Iโ€™m an indie dev that created a desktop app (electron) to design and print labels. I sell a one-time license for $147 but also a subscription for $14.99/month. About 20% of my revenue is MRR. Itโ€™s up to the user, and they seem to love it when they have this choice. Is it sustainable for me? I think so. I license per computer. My largest customers have 20+... - Source: Hacker News / over 3 years ago
